Retinal Implants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Retinal Implants Market Size was estimated at 26.3 USD Billion in 2024. The Retinal Implants industry is projected to grow from 28.55 USD Billion in 2025 to 64.8 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.54 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

By Technology: Electronic Retinal Implants (Largest) vs. Photovoltaic Retinal Implants (Fastest-Growing)

The retinal implants market is primarily divided among three categories: electronic retinal implants, photovoltaic retinal implants, and optogenetic retinal implants. Currently, electronic retinal implants hold the largest market share, thanks to their established technology and widespread acceptance in clinical settings. Meanwhile, photovoltaic retinal implants are rapidly gaining ground, representing the fastest-growing segment within this market due to their innovative approach to vision restoration and advancements in material science that enhance their functionality.

Electronic Retinal Implants: Dominant vs. Photovoltaic Retinal Implants: Emerging

Electronic retinal implants are the dominant technology in the retinal implants market, leveraging electronic stimulation to restore vision in individuals with retinal degenerative diseases. Their commercial availability and proven effectiveness make them the go-to option for many clinicians. Conversely, photovoltaic retinal implants are an emerging technology that harnesses light to stimulate retinal cells, showing promise for patients with less advanced stages of retinal disease. This innovative approach, along with ongoing improvements in photovoltaic materials, positions them as a leading contender in future market growth, appealing especially to those seeking cutting-edge solutions in vision restoration.

Industry Developments

June 2020 LambdaVision, an innovative biotechnology company developing a novel treatment to help patients regain sight, has been selected by NASA for a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) Phase II award worth $750,000 over two years. With the continued support of NASA, LambdaVision will advance the development of its protein-based artificial retina. This award complements a recent $5M NASA Commercialization Award received by LambdaVision and its partner, Space Tango, for continued work on the International Space Station (ISS) to establish pilot-scale production systems for artificial retina and other future biomedical applications.

July 2022 Nidek Co., Ltd. acquired 90% shares of Nidek Medical S.R.L., a sales and service company of ophthalmic devices. This acquisition will help the company to increase the success between Nidek Medical and Nidek.
